Module: xenomai-forge Branch: master Commit: 4c49dec8d6b4aaf45d2878d7cdb9c9dd52b31bcb URL: http://git.xenomai.org/?p=xenomai-forge.git;a=commit;h=4c49dec8d6b4aaf45d2878d7cdb9c9dd52b31bcb
Author: Philippe Gerum <[email protected]> Date: Sat Nov 5 18:46:11 2011 +0100 alchemy/task: fix CPU affinity setting --- lib/alchemy/task.c | 2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/lib/alchemy/task.c b/lib/alchemy/task.c index 7b149c4..9404b5b 100644 --- a/lib/alchemy/task.c +++ b/lib/alchemy/task.c @@ -229,7 +229,7 @@ static int create_tcb(struct alchemy_task **tcbp, CPU_ZERO(&tcb->affinity); for (cpu = 0; cpu < 8; cpu++) { - if (T_CPU(cpu)) + if (mode & T_CPU(cpu)) CPU_SET(cpu, &tcb->affinity); } _______________________________________________ Xenomai-git mailing list [email protected] https://mail.gna.org/listinfo/xenomai-git
